FATF Updates List of Jurisdictions With AML, Sanctions Compliance Deficiencies
The intergovernmental Financial Action Task Force recently updated its list of jurisdictions with “deficiencies” in combating terrorism financing, weapons proliferation and other sanctions-related issues, the Financial Crimes Enforcement Network said June 23.
